What is the magnitude and direction of 2i + J vector |
|
Answer» Explanation: MAGNITUDE AND DIRECTION OF A VECTOR. Given a position vector →v=⟨a,b⟩,the magnitude is found by |v|=√a2+b2. The direction is EQUAL to the angle FORMED with the x-axis, or with the y-axis, depending on the APPLICATION. For a position vector, the direction is found by tanθ=(ba)⇒θ=tan−1(ba), as illustrated in Figure 8.8. |
